Reflexx wrote:
With Glenn being a main character since the beginning, I felt his death was minimized a bit by sharing it with Abraham.

I think they should have killed Abraham as the season finale of Season 6. Let fans process that.

Then at the beginning of season 7 show them it wasn't done and kill Glenn.


I agreed with this and mentioned this to someone else who told me why it wouldn't work.

If Abraham died at the end of 6 fans would complain that all that buildup to have it be Abraham, who isn't that big of a character, and that they should have done Glenn like in the comics but the writers were too scared. Then if Glenn died in season 7 opener they would say that the writers caved in to fan pressure.

I think it could have worked that way but this is a reasonable explanation as to why they didn't do it that way.

Just finished ep2.

Rick's group's story arc has taken a really dark turn lately and even Rick seems to have lost his grip on humanity. Now with Negan in the picture it appears that things are going to be getting worse.

Which is why I really like the introduction of Ezekiel and the Kingdom as it brings a little hope and balance to the show. He's genuinely a good person. That said he's a "realist" as he put it and he's a bad ass which kinda makes him the character we all hoped Morgan would turn out to be.
